Serve moment from window object

This commit is contained in:
Paulus Schoutsen 2016-05-28 11:15:37 -07:00
parent d7993a8899
commit c50b0c991c
5 changed files with 6 additions and 11 deletions

View File

@ -1,4 +1,3 @@
import moment from 'moment';
import Polymer from '../polymer';
const UPDATE_INTERVAL = 60000; // 60 seconds
@ -53,6 +52,6 @@ export default new Polymer({
updateRelative() {
this.relativeTime = this.parsedDateTime ?
moment(this.parsedDateTime).fromNow() : '';
window.moment(this.parsedDateTime).fromNow() : '';
},
});

View File

@ -1,8 +1,10 @@
import moment from 'moment';
import Polymer from './polymer';
import HomeAssistant from 'home-assistant-js';
import nuclearObserver from './util/bound-nuclear-behavior';
import validateAuth from './util/validate-auth';
window.moment = moment;
require('./layouts/login-form');
require('./layouts/home-assistant-main');

View File

@ -1,5 +1,3 @@
import moment from 'moment';
export default function formatDateTime(dateObj) {
return moment(dateObj).format('lll');
return window.moment(dateObj).format('lll');
}

View File

@ -1,5 +1,3 @@
import moment from 'moment';
export default function formatDate(dateObj) {
return moment(dateObj).format('ll');
return window.moment(dateObj).format('ll');
}

View File

@ -1,5 +1,3 @@
import moment from 'moment';
export default function formatTime(dateObj) {
return moment(dateObj).format('LT');
return window.moment(dateObj).format('LT');
}